
Yossing Liemlerd
Yossing Liemlerd, a prominent figure in Thai politics, has transitioned from a local government leader in Chachoengsao province to a key player in the national cabinet. With a background in military service and a master's degree in justice and social administration, he has served multiple terms as the head of local administrative organizations and has recently been appointed as the Minister of Industry in the cabinet of Anutin Charnvirakul, reflecting his close association with influential politician Suchart Chomklin.
